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day in Little India , a colorful and vibrant neighborhood known for its Indian cuisine and shops. Visit the Sri Veeramakaliamman Temple and the Mustafa Centre for a unique shopping experience.
Afternoon
Head to Merlion Park to see the iconic Merlion statue, which symbolizes Singapore's origins as a fishing village. Afterward, explore Singapore Chinatown for its temples, markets and traditional architecture.
Morning
Visit Singapore Botanical Garden & National Orchid Garden , a UNESCO World Heritage site that features a variety of plants and flowers, including over 1,000 species of orchids. Afterward, take a ride on the Singapore Flyer , one of the world's largest observation wheels, for stunning views of the city.
Afternoon
Experience the unique Night Safari at Singapore Zoo , where you can see nocturnal animals in their natural habitats. Afterward, take a stroll along Marina Bay and admire the beautiful skyline.
Morning
Take a stroll along the Singapore River , which played a critical role in Singapore's history as a trading port. Visit the Gardens by the Bay , a futuristic park that features a variety of gardens and attractions, including the Supertree Grove .
Afternoon
Explore Kampong Glam , a neighborhood that features colorful shophouses, street art, and the historic Sultan Mosque (Masjid Sultan) . Afterward, visit Raffles Hotel , a historic hotel that has hosted many famous guests.
Morning
Visit the Helix Bridge , a pedestrian bridge that offers stunning views of Marina Bay. Afterward, explore Esplanade Theatres on the Bay , a performing arts center that features a variety of shows and events.
Afternoon
Take a cable car ride to Mount Faber Park , a hilltop park that offers panoramic views of the city skyline and the harbor. Afterward, explore Boat Quay , a historic area that features colorful shophouses and a variety of restaurants and bars.
Morning
Visit the National Museum of Singapore , which houses a vast collection of artifacts and exhibits that tell the story of Singapore's history and culture. Afterward, visit the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um , which houses a relic of the Buddha and a variety of Buddhist artifacts.
Afternoon
Explore Marina Bay Sands , a luxury resort that features a variety of shops, restaurants, and attractions, including the ArtScience Museum and the SkyPark Observation Deck. Afterward, visit River Safari , a river-themed zoo that features over 6,000 animals.
